    what setting do you use for a Scotts edge guard dlx when spreading Talstar XTRA granules?
    to get rid of mole crickets
    A

    The Talstar Xtra bag does not specifically list setting for the Scotts Edge Guard DLX.  You would want to calibrate your spreader for the product for your target pest. Here are instructions on how to calibrate your spreader. 

    Almost all fertilizers, herbicides, insecticides, etc have treatments in amounts of so much product per 1000 square feet.  So if you can figure out what your walking speed is then you know anytime you apply any product that calls for so much of it per 1000 square feet, you always set your spreader on this setting.  You can calibrate this by marking off a 1000 square foot (10 x 100) area and placing the required amount of product in pounds in the spreader.  Start with a low setting and start walking your marked off area at a normal pace.  You can adjust as you go and find the basic setting for you to apply the product over a 1000 square feet.

    For mole crickets the rate to use is 2.3 to 4.6 Lbs/1000 sq ft

    Do Talstar Xtra Granules need to be watered in?
    Have a lesco broadcast spreader; need to know what setting for fire ants. And do I need to water in?
    A

    Talstar Xtra Granules do need to be watered in after the product is applied. The application rate is 2.3 - 4.6 lbs per 1000 square feet. The ratio for the Lesco Broadcast Spreader 4-5.8 rate.

    What setting do you use for a speedy green 3000 spreader when applying Talstar XTRA Granules?
    A
    When using a Speedy Green 3000 for Talstar XTRA granules, you should set your spreader on a number 6 setting, which will apply 2.3 lbs per 1000 square feet when walking at 3 miles per hour.

    Can Talstar XTRA Granules be used around a home with cats?
    A

    Yes, Talstar XTRA Granules can be used around a home that has pets. Talstar XTRA is a granule that would be applied with a broadcast spreader and then watered in by 1/4 inch of irrigation or rainfall to activate the product. Once you have watered in the Talstar XTRA and allow it to completely dry, Talstar XTRA is completely safe for pets.

    How often to spread Talstar XTRA Granules?
    Do you spread in early Spring and late Fall?
    A

    Talstar XTRA Granules will last up to 4 months so you can apply once a quarter.
